κατεργάζομαι

Non-contract Verb; 이상동사 자동번역 Transliteration:

Principal Part: κατεργάζομαι κατεργάσομαι κατειργασάμην κατείργασμαι

Structure: κατ (Prefix) + ἐργάζ (Stem) + ομαι (Ending)

Etym.: perf. -ei/rgasmai

Sense

  1. to effect by labor, to achieve, accomplish
  2. to work up for use
  3. to work at, practice
  4. to level
